Gold Prices Climb in Pakistan; 24-Karat Hits Rs 251,900 Per Tola

On Wednesday, gold prices in Pakistan continued their upward trend, with 24-karat gold reaching Rs 251,900 per tola, marking an increase of Rs 2,200.

Dealers noted a corresponding rise in the price of 10 grams of 24-karat gold, which climbed by Rs 1,887 to Rs 215,964. The price for 10 grams of 22-karat gold also increased, now trading at Rs 197,967.

These price movements are closely tied to fluctuations in the US Dollar, highlighting the strong correlation between currency value and gold prices. This connection emphasizes the influence of global economic conditions on the local gold market.0

The current price for 24-karat silver is Rs 2,780. Gold prices rose by $21 on the international market, reaching $2,412 per ounce.

It is crucial to note that gold prices in Pakistan can fluctuate significantly throughout the day due to global market trends. The prices mentioned are based on reliable sources from Karachi and Multan.

Individuals should consult local gold merchants and jewellers for the latest and most accurate gold price information.
